    Abstract This paper proposes a new modeling method that equivalently transforms interdependent and correlated facility failures in an infrastructure system into only i.i.d. disruptions in a supporting structure. The properties of this structure are examined and a mathematical model is created to solve reliable facility location design problems under correlated facility failure risks. This model is formulated into a compact integer linear program and can be efficiently solved by state-of-the-art solvers. A set of experiments and case studies are conducted to demonstrate the applicability of the proposed model and to draw managerial insights into the optimal system design.
